Customer Technology Specialist - BI WORLDWIDE - Edina, MN

We bring experience, with global reach and resources with offices in the U.S., Australia, Canada, China, Latin America, India, Singapore, and the United Kingdom...
From BI Worldwide - Fri, 24 Mar 2017 02:45:03 GMT - View all Edina jobs

from Australia Jobs | Indeed.com http://ift.tt/2nXcUn0

Related Posts